Which one of the following statements is INCORRECT?

a. A federal grand jury can refuse to return an indictment requested by a United States
Attorney.
b. A grand jury can receive and consider hearsay testimony.
c. A grand jury does not have to honor an evidentiary privilege such as the marital
privilege.
d. Federal grand juries comprise sixteen to twenty-three persons, yet the “12 votes for
indictment” rule applies in every case.


Answer: C
